   Keysight (Agilent) 8703A   Description / Specification:    
Keysight (Agilent) 8703A 20 GHz Lightwave Component Analyzer

The Agilent 8703A Lightwave Component Analyzer is a manufacturing test solution for diverse optical and electro-optical components, assemblies and devices as lasers and LEDs, photodiodes, fiber cables, connectors and transmitter/receiver pairs. Measurements can also be made on electrical microwave components such as amplifiers, cables, connectors, attenuators, and waveguides. Specifications. Electrical Source. Frequency Range: 130 MHz to 20 GHz. Output Power Range: +5 to -50 dBm in 5 dB steps at Port 1; -15 to -70 dBm in 5 dB steps at Port 2. Output Power Level: +5 dBm ± 3 dB at Port 1; -15 dBm plus coupler roll-off at Port 2. Connector Type: 3.5 mm (male). Lightwave Source. Wavelength: Standard (FP laser) 1308 ± 10 nm, Opt 210 (DFP laser) 1550 ± 10 nm, Opt 220 (DFP laser) 1308 ± 10 nm. Modulation Frequency Range: 130 MHz to 20 GHz. Compatible Fiber: 9/125 um.

Multimode Fiber
Multimode Fiber has a large core (almost always 62.5 microns - a micron is one one millionth of a meter - but sometimes 50 microns) and is used with LED sources at wavelengths of 850 and 1300 nm for short distance, lower speed networks like LANs. Both multimode and singlemode fiber have an outside diameter of 125 microns - about 5 thousandths of an inch - just slightly larger than a human hair.

Power Repeatability
Power Repeatability is the random uncertainty in reproducing the power level after changing and re-setting the power level. The power repeatability is ± half the span (in dB) between the highest and lowest actual power. Note: - The long-term power repeatability can be obtained by taken the power repeatability and power stability into account.

Refractive Index
The refractive index or index of refraction of a substance is a measure of the speed of light in that substance. It is expressed as a ratio of the speed of light in vacuum relative to that in the considered medium. The velocity at which light travels in vacuum is a physical constant, and the fastest speed at which energy or information can be transferred. However, light travels slower through any given material, or medium, that is not vacuum.
